Chocolate Marble Bundt Cake

Prep Time: 20 minutes

Cook Time: 65 minutes

Total Time: 85 minutes

Yield: 12 to 16 servings

Ingredients:

  • 4 ounces semi- or bittersweet chocolate, melted and cooled

  • 12 ounces (1-1/2 cups) butter, softened

  • 3-3/4 cups (approx. 1 pound) powdered sugar

  • 6 eggs

  • 1 tablespoon vanilla extract

  • 3 cups flour

Preheat oven to 325 degrees F. Grease and flour regular tube pan or Bundt Cake Pan. Cream

butter and sugar until light and fluffy. Add eggs one at a time. Mixing after each addition. Add vanilla. Gradually add flour. Mix well. Remove 1/3 of cake batter to smaller bowl. Mix in melted chocolate. Set aside. Add half of remaining batter to cake pan. Spoon chocolate batter on top. Add rest of plain cake batter.

Take a knife and cut through batter to marble cake. Bake for 58 - 75 minutes. Use cake tester to test for doneness. Allow to cool in pan for 10 minutes. Remove to wire rack and cool completely. Top Chocolate Marble Cake with prepared glaze of your choice.

Chocolate Glaze:

Ingredients:

  • 1/2 cup semisweet chocolate chips

  • 1/4 cup dark chocolate*

  • 3 tablespoons butter

  • 1 tablespoon light corn syrup

  • 1/4 teaspoon extract vanilla

Place all ingredients in pan over top of pan of hot water. Stir occasionally until chocolate is melted and ingredients are combined. Drizzle over bundt cake.
